    Wonder Woman's Golden Age Rogues gallery, as drawn by H.G. Peters

    Wonder Woman Golden Age Foes.jpg

    1st Row: Cheetah, Mars, Deception, Greed, Conquest, Hercules, Paula von Gunther
    2nd Row: Psycho, Giganta, Queen Clea, Dr. Poison, Eviless, Zara, Blue Snowman, Hypnota
    3rd Row: Angle Man, Gundra, Minister Blizzard, the Mask, King Blakfu, Queen Atomia, Sharkeeta, Badra
    4th Row: Queen Flamina, Queen Celerita, King Rigor, King Solo, Great Blue Father, Purple Priestess, Tassle King, Aknaten
    5th Row: Ironsides, Tigra Tropica, King Crystallar, King Brutaal, Draska Nishki, Uvo, Queen Pallida, Professor Manly
